Frequently Asked Questions about Scottsdale Area

How much are Studio apartments in Scottsdale Area?

There are currently 80 Studio Apartments in Scottsdale Area with rent ranges from $1,800 to $3,460 with an average price of $2,251.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Scottsdale Area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Scottsdale Area ranges from $1,950 to $3,720 with an average monthly rent of $2,532.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Scottsdale Area c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Scottsdale Area range from $2,044 to $4,815.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,059.
